The market involves technologies and systems designed to identify leaks in pipelines, tanks, and pressurized systems across industries such as oil & gas, water treatment, chemicals, and HVAC. It includes methods like acoustic monitoring, thermal imaging, tracer gas detection, and digital pressure analysis.
Formulations range from sensor-based platforms to smart software integration. These solutions are used to prevent product loss, ensure safety, and meet environmental standards. Market Driver
Rising Demand in the Petrochemical and Refining Industry
Leak detection has become critical in the petrochemical sector, where volatile and hazardous materials are transported and processed. Any leakage in such facilities poses safety risks and leads to environmental concerns.
Operators in refineries and chemical plants are adopting robust detection technologies for pipelines, storage tanks, and processing units. This rising industry-wide implementation of leak detection technologies is fueling the market, especially in regions with strong refining activities.
Market Challenge
High Installation and Maintenance Costs
A significant challenge affecting the growth of the leak detection market is the high cost of installing and maintaining advanced systems. This is especially critical for large-scale facilities and pipeline networks, where integration of real-time sensors and monitoring infrastructure can be financially burdensome.
Market players are offering modular and scalable solutions that allow phased implementation. Some are also investing in wireless sensor technologies to reduce installation complexity. Additionally, predictive maintenance tools and remote diagnostics are helping lower long-term operational costs, making these systems more accessible and financially viable for a broad range of end users.
Market Trend
Advancements in Sensing and Monitoring Technologies
The development of high-precision sensors, UAV-based technology, infrared cameras, and cloud-based analytics is transforming leak detection. Newer technologies provide better sensitivity, quicker response, and remote access to data.
These advancements have expanded the applications of detection systems beyond traditional sectors. Industries now benefit from scalable, real-time monitoring. The ability to detect small leaks with higher accuracy is accelerating adoption, boosting the market globally.

Market Segmentation
Based on region, the global market has been classified into North America, Europe, Asia Pacific, Middle East & Africa, and South America.
Asia Pacific accounted for 35.03% share of the leak detection market in 2023, with a valuation of USD 1359.4 million. The region is undergoing rapid infrastructure upgrades, especially in energy transmission and urban utilities. Governments and private operators are investing in new pipeline networks for oil, gas, and water.
At the same time, older pipelines are being assessed and retrofitted. These projects require both embedded and portable leak detection technologies. The growing need for safe and efficient pipeline operation across new and legacy systems is driving the market in Asia Pacific.
Moreover, utility providers in Asia Pacific are adopting smart technologies to manage urban services more efficiently. Cities are deploying sensor-based leak detection in water & gas distribution networks to reduce losses and improve service reliability.
The leak detection industry in North America is poised for significant growth at a robust CAGR of 4.58% over the forecast period. North America has some of the most detailed regulations for leak detection, especially in the oil, gas, and chemical sectors. These regulations compel operators to invest in certified detection technologies. The demand for compliant, automated systems is steadily driving the market in North America.
Furthermore, leak detection systems in North America are increasingly integrated with digital control networks and SCADA systems. The demand for cyber-resilient monitoring systems is becoming a key factor in purchase decisions, influencing the growth of the market in North America.
